The run capacitor stores and releases electrical energy to keep the motor windings phased correctly, giving the blower and compressor motors the steady torque they need to run efficiently. A dual round capacitor serves both the indoor blower and the outdoor compressor from one can. When it weakens, motors struggle to start and run hot: you may hear a hum from a motor that won't spin, notice the blower or compressor short-cycling on overload, warm air on a cooling call, a tripped breaker, or a visibly bulged/leaking capacitor top. A failing capacitor is the single most common no-cool service call. This is a dual-rated run capacitor with separate HERM (compressor) and FAN (blower) terminals plus a common. It is built to OEM ±5% capacitance tolerance and rated at the unit's specified microfarad (MFD/µF) values and 370 or 440 VAC. Always match the printed MFD and voltage on your existing can exactly — using equal or higher voltage is fine, but MFD must match. OEM matters because capacitance is precise. A generic capacitor with a wide ±10-15% tolerance can deliver too little MFD, which under-energizes the start winding and forces the compressor to draw locked-rotor current. That heat cooks the windings and dramatically shortens compressor life. The genuine Carrier capacitor holds tight ±5% tolerance and a full-rated voltage for long service life. Install difficulty: 2 of 5. Tools: 1/4" nut driver, needle-nose pliers, and a multimeter with capacitance test. SAFETY: a charged capacitor can deliver a dangerous shock — kill the breaker AND discharge the capacitor across its terminals with an insulated screwdriver before touching the leads.
